Ich möchte einige Verlaufseinträge, die über history.pushState
hinzugefügt wurden, vollständig entfernen, anstatt history.replaceState
zu verwenden, um sie zu ändern. Wie soll ich das erreichen?Wie Geschichteinträge gelöscht werden, die durch history.pushstate hinzugefügt wurden?
6
A
Antwort
1
Bearbeiten von vorherigen Verlaufseinträgen ist nicht möglich. Aus der Geschichte Dokumentation:
Alle Getter und Setter für Attribute und alle Methoden, über die Geschichte Schnittstelle definiert, wenn sie auf einem History-Objekt mit einem Dokument zugeordnet ist aufgerufen, die nicht vollständig aktiv ist, muss eine Security werfen
Ausnahme
http://www.whatwg.org/specs/web-apps/current-work/multipage/history.html#the-history-interface
Verwandte Themen
- 1. Zeilen werden hinzugefügt, die nicht gemacht wurden
- 2. Wie viele Zeilen wurden gelöscht?
- 3. Werden Objekte, die im Konstruktor erstellt wurden, auch durch "using" gelöscht?
- 4. Wie kann ich "inverse" entfernen, die durch die Konventionen für fließende Nihbernate hinzugefügt wurden?
- 5. Wie strukturieren Sie die Felder, die Logstash-Ereignissen hinzugefügt wurden?
- 6. Die Werte von Elementen, die mit jQuery gelöscht wurden, erhalten?
- 7. Wie Sie wissen, ob alle Zellen mit MGSwipeTableCell gelöscht wurden
- 8. Javascript history.pushState
- 9. Javascript - "history.pushState" ersetzt reguläres "&" durch "&". Wie man es vermeidet?
- 10. Können gelöschte Dateien, die in Git hinzugefügt, aber nicht festgeschrieben wurden, wiederhergestellt werden?
- 11. Entitäten wurden möglicherweise geändert oder gelöscht, da Entitäten geladen wurden.
- 12. Wie können Dateien wiederhergestellt werden, die im tortoisehg-Programm aus dem Regal gelöscht wurden?
- 13. Anhänge, die über die JavaScript-Funktion hinzugefügt wurden, werden nicht gesendet.
- 14. Textmate zeigt Dateien im Projektordner an, die gelöscht wurden
- 15. WP7 - Isolierte Speichereinstellungen wurden bei "Rebuild" gelöscht
- 16. AngularJS: Wie Event-Handler von einem Element entfernt werden, die von einer Direktive hinzugefügt wurden?
- 17. MySQL: Abrufen von Zeilen, die letzte Stunde hinzugefügt wurden
- 18. Warum werden die erstellten T4-Ausgänge gelöscht?
- 19. Assetic generiert mehrere CSS-Dateien, die gelöscht wurden
- 20. Überprüfen Sie, ob Programmoptionen hinzugefügt wurden
- 21. Spalten mit Zuordnungen zugeordnet wurden/umbenannt gelöscht
- 22. Berechnung der Gesamtlinien nach einer Zusammenführung hinzugefügt/gelöscht?
- 23. Warum werden die Werte von dplyr nicht durch die Bedingung gelöscht?
- 24. Entfernen Sie die App-Referenz, nachdem Modellabhängigkeiten hinzugefügt wurden
- 25. Können die Routenwerte mit RedirectToAction gelöscht werden?
- 26. Warum kann die Datei nicht gelöscht werden?
- 27. Die älteste Tabellenpartition konnte nicht gelöscht werden
- 28. Alle Bilder löschen, die zur Leinwand hinzugefügt wurden
- 29. Listview Artikel wurden an falscher Stelle hinzugefügt
- 30. Wie wird angezeigt, ob eine Sammlung hinzugefügt oder gelöscht wurde?
denke ich, dass eine Sicherheitslücke wäre. –